Understanding Imported Tiles in Bijnor
Imported tiles in Bijnor offer a range of luxury designs and specifications, sourced primarily from Italy, Spain, and other premium manufacturing hubs. These tiles typically feature advanced digital printing technology for ultra-realistic patterns, precise rectification for minimal grout lines, and robust body compositions for long-term use. Demand for imported options is concentrated in upscale residential projects and commercial establishments seeking a distinct, global aesthetic. These high-quality vitrified tiles conform to international standards, often equivalent to IS 15622:2006, ensuring water absorption rates below 0.05%.

Imported Tiles Price List in Bijnor (Rs./sq.ft)
Imported tile prices in Bijnor reflect their premium quality, unique designs, and the logistics involved in bringing them from international markets. While prices can vary due to exchange rates and freight, this table gives an indicative range for common categories. All figures are in Rs./sq.ft.
| Tile Type | Best Application | Price Range (Rs./sq.ft) |
| Imported Wall Decor/Highlighters | Bathrooms, kitchen backsplashes | Rs. 95 to Rs. 170+ |
| Premium Spanish/Italian Ceramic | Master bathroom walls | Rs. 135 to Rs. 270+ |
| Large Format Floor Slabs (2x4, 32x64, etc.) | Luxury living rooms, seamless floors | Rs. 165 to Rs. 325+ |
| Bookmatch Imported Slabs | TV units, double-height feature walls | Rs. 195 to Rs. 375+ |
| Speciality Metallic/Carving Tiles | Feature walls, premium boutiques | Rs. 215 to Rs. 425+ |
Sourcing Imported Tiles and Installation in Bijnor
Sourcing imported tiles in Bijnor requires careful planning and coordination, often through dealer clusters along Mandi area or near the main bus stand where building material suppliers are concentrated. It is important to place orders at least 15 to 20 working days before installation to account for lead times, especially if specific designs need to be brought from port hubs like Delhi. Always order 10% to 15% extra material to cover cuts and potential damages, as replacements can take months. For large-format slab tiles, specialist polymer adhesive and experienced masons with proper tools are crucial for a flawless fix.
